Calculate Log Base 173 of 91

To solve the equation log 173 (91)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 91, a = 173:
    log 173 (91) = log(91) / log(173)
  3. Evaluate the term:
    log(91) / log(173)
    = 1.39794000867204 / 1.92427928606188
    = 0.87533558383018
    = Logarithm of 91 with base 173
